Maryan is a 2013 Indian Tamil romantic survival film directed by Bharat Bala starring Dhanush alongside Parvathy Thiruvothu. Produced by Venu Ravichandran, the film has music and background score composed by A. R. Rahman and cinematography by Marc Koninckx. Dialogues in the film are penned by R N Joe D' Cruz.

The film revolves around a story of human survival adapted from a newspaper article of a real-life crisis event, when three oil workers from Tamil Nadu were kidnapped and taken hostage in Sudan by mercenaries. The film is an emotional journey of a common man to an unknown place with the hope to come home and lead a better life. The film released in Auro 3D sound format on selective screens in India and worldwide on 19 July 2013. The film received positive critical reception in India. The film had the biggest opening in the United States amongst all Indian films releasing on the same date. However, in Tamil Nadu the film was declared as an average grosser. The dubbed Telugu version of the film titled 'Mariyaan' was released on 11 September 2015.

Mariyaan Joseph is a fisherman in a village named Neerody in Kanyakumari. He has an auspicious bond with sea and proudly claims himself as "Kadal Raasa" (King of Ocean). Panimalar falls in love with Maryan and does not shy away in confessing it to him. Maryan is loved and longed by Panimalar, but sadly, her feelings are not reciprocated. The more Maryan tries to keep Panimalar away from him, the closer she tries to get. This eventually leads to him falling for her. Once, Panimalar is caught in unfortunate circumstances and to support her financially, Maryan is forced to take up employment on contract basis for two years in Sudan. He then befriends Saami, and he is his only companion for Four years. He successfully completes his tenure and packs bags in jubilation to return to his ladylove, but tragedy strikes in the form of Sudanese terrorists, who end up kidnapping Maryan and two of his coworkers, demanding money for their freedom. One of his coworkers gets killed by the head terrorist. After 21 days in captivity, Maryan escapes with Saami and runs for his life. He gets separated from Saami, who gets killed later on, and gets lost in the desert and suffers from dehydration and confronts cheetahs as his mirage. After finding the coast, he fights the terrorist who catches up with him and escapes. He then returns to his village where his love is waiting for him.
